BN66 LXK is a 2016 Jaguar Xe in Black with a 1,999c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.
Across all 2016 Jaguar Xe models, the average MOT pass rate is 84.0% with a typical mileage of 51,452 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The Jaguar Xe typically stays on UK roads for around 11 years. At 10 years old, this Jaguar Xe is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
